Ok ladies, I wanted to share my experience with a few of our vendors we used for our 9/11 wedding. We got married in the Queensbury area, but the vendors we used are based out of Albany/Clifton Park area, so for those of you getting married in these areas, this will help you!

We used Aficionade Limo both for our wedding day limo and to drive us to the airport and back for the honeymoon. Billy Osta, the owner is GREAT! The prices were VERY reasonable, and were the best we found. The limo itself was so cool! We used the Chrystler 300 which was silver and so sleek. The inside was beautiful, stocked with a couple bottles of champange, bottled water, and of course champagne flutes.The driver was very friendly and fun. I can't say enough good things about them and would highly recommend them to anyone!

Our photographer was Robbin Manuel of Special Events Remembered. We met with her once before deciding on her. At our meeting she came comletely prepared with several albums of her work and a sheet with pricing and details for  the packages she offers. We though she was fun and down for anything as well as very talented and decided to go with her pretty much right after meeting with her. The day of the wedding she showed up full of energy and ready to go! We loved that she had no problem asking people to move this way and that, or certain poses, or to leave the room entirely so that she could get photos of just my fiance and myself. She took control and got the job done all while being friendly and fun. We had so many people come up to us and say that she was great. She also had an assistant with her, a young girl, who was also great. She would hold my bouquet and my train for me and she also had a camera and took pictures, many of which were absolutely stunning!

Another great perk of our photographer is she posts pictures as soon as the day after the wedding! It's only been 8 days and she has posted 110 photos already for us to view! I LOVE looking at pictures so for me this is such a huge deal.

For our dj we used Kenny Casanova. We picked him mostly because his price was SO good. We didn't get a chance to meet with him in person or watch him in action. On our wedding day, he was GREAT! He played the songs we wanted, he would make sure certain songs people requested were ok with us before playing them, and he knew how to keep the party going strong! My great grandfather was even up dancing!!! We even had an incident where the fire alarm went off ( a child pulled it in the hotel) and he played songs about fire and stuff and people thought it was hilarious. People were having so much fun we extended our reception for another hour and he gave us a decent price on adding another hour. People were having so much fun they didn't want to go home!


I hope I helped someone who is looking for one or more of these vendors for their wedding. I know when I was looking, I didn't find much help as far as recommendations from other brides. Good luck!

    We also used Kenny Casanova! We agree he was a lot of fun and also at a great price. He had a great start price and lots of options to customize the wedding so we got and only paid for just what we wanted. In the end, we added three packages and he was still about 30% cheaper than the other four DJs we had contacted.

    He was really easy to work with, super laid back and understanding and very accomodating. He is out of Troy or Albany, NY area I think. We highly recommended him!
